A circle is drawn within a square as shown.

<h3>Area of shaded region is 21.5 square centimeter</h3>

<em><u>Solution:</u></em>

The area of the shaded region is equal to the area of the square minus the area of the circle

<em><u> Find the area of the square</u></em>

Area\ of\ square = a^2

Where, "a" is the length of each side

From given figure in question,

a = 10 cm

Area\ of\ square = 10^2\\\\Area\ of\ square = 100\ cm^2

<em><u>Find the area of circle </u></em>

The area of the circle is given as:

Area\ of\ circle = \pi r^2

Where, "r" is the radius of circle

Diameter = 10 cm

r = \frac{diameter}{2}\\\\r = \frac{10}{2}\\\\r = 5

Thus,

Area\ of\ circle = 3.14 \times 5^2\\\\Area\ of\ circle = 3.14 \times 25\\\\Area\ of\ circle = 78.5\ cm^2

<em><u>Find the area of the shaded region</u></em>

Area of shaded Region = Area of Square - Area of Circle

Area of shaded Region = 100 - 78.5 = 21.5

Thus area of shaded region is 21.5 square centimeter

Grace's car left four skid marks on the road surface during a highway accident. Two of the skid marks were each 52 feet and two
Mashcka [7]

Answer:

The skid distance to be used is 54 feet.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Four skid marks on the highway.

52,52,56,56  in feet.

We have to find the skid distance.

The skid distance that will be used to further calculate the skid speed is actually the mean skid distance.

Mean skid distance (m) :

⇒ (m)=\frac{Sum\ of \ the\ skid\ marks }{Number\ of\ skid\ marks}

⇒ (m) =\frac{52+52+56+56}{4}

⇒ (m) =\frac{216}{4}

⇒ (m)=54  feet.

So the skid distance to be used is 54 feet.
